Crusade: Issue 58 - Terror in Times Square


The eye of the storm covered several blocks of downtown Center City. It was centered on 7th Avenue, 42nd Street, and Broadway. What the citizens of Center City liked to call Megalopolis Times Square.

The storm had evacuated everyone from the area. It now was acting as barricade. It roads were blocked and the area was sealed off. Black Orchid knew this was why the storm had been created. Something was about to happened there. She had to tell the New Crusaders.

The Black Orchid noticed that she was close to the center. No more time for idle analysis! “The Black Orchid to all team members,” she called over the radio. “The storm is centered on Times Square and it is not moving. Something is going to happen at that location soon and we need to be there. Everything else is a diversion to keep us busy and away! The storm is magical not scientific in nature so be prepared for anything!” She bolted up from the console and rushed out to make it Times Square, desperately hoping she has not wasted too much time already. 

All across the Megalopolis Black Orchid’s call to the New Crusaders was heard.

At this point, the picture of the news Jessica was replaced by a picture of a darkened room. In the center foreground was a man in a black costume and cape. His features from the shoulders up are hidden in shadow, but his eyes seem to shine out through the darkness. He spoke in a low and well modulated voice:

“I am Doctor Apocalypse, Earth’s Sorcerer Supreme. I am the author of the tempest that grips the eastern United States in its terrible gauntlet. These are my demands. I suggest that you heed them:

“In nine days, the Congress of the United States of America will pass a resolution declaring that the Refuge Islands of Megalopolis shall be a separate and sovereign state, independent from the United States and deeded wholly and completely over to myself.

“No later than the following day, the President of the United States will sign that resolution into law. In addition, the President will have drafted by that time, and be prepared to sign, a treaty of non-interference with the new state, and with me as its absolute monarch.

“Within three days following this, the government of the state will ratify this law and will initiate procedures to evacuate the Refuge Islands of Megalopolis. No later than thirty days after the law is ratified by the state legislature, the Refuge Islands shall be completely evacuated of all of its current residents. Anyone remaining will become my citizens and forfeit their American Citizenships. There will be no dual citizenships allowed or granted.

“If these demands are not met, in strict adherence to the schedule I have stated, I shall destroy a major city of the United States. I will continue to do this every day that you fail to comply with my demands.

“Do not think for a moment that your military or your technology can protect you from me. I am your technological superior. I can defeat you strategically; I can crush you psychically; I can destroy you supernaturally!

“If you are wise men, then you will let the evidence that I have already shown you be enough; you will let the disasters that have already occurred be the last. To underestimate me would be a terrible mistake. Unfortunately, I do not believe that you are wise men. I believe that most of you will be foolishly skeptical of my powers. For you, I have arranged for there to be one additional demonstration of my abilities. You have tasted my supernatural power; tomorrow I will show you something of my technological might. This demonstration will take place at sunrise today in the center of Times Square. You may respond to this situation as you see fit. As for the storm, I will end it now.

“You will not hear from me again unless you disappoint me.”

The video transmission ends.

… William stretched out his arms and yawned, drawing in the cool fresh air of the early morning. He looked at the sky and decided that it was going to be another cold day, a good day for hunting. Donnah stepped out from the Steading, “So Sensei, it looks like it might snow later” - she predicted as she looked up. “What is the plan for the day?”

William grinned, he liked Donnah - she had a spark to her. He had agreed to help with her training, well agreed with Clinton Avery - Donnah’s grandfather; the original Dr Arcane and that mantle were passed onto Donnah. Clearly she had an aptitude for the mystical arts but within William’s little neck of the woods of sorcery: druidism; were a bit more...primal - and that required different skills. Avery had said that his granddaughter had an affinity for ‘natural magic’ on account of her once being transformed into an air elemental, hopefully this training session should draw that out.

William stared up at the sky and nodded; I think you are right Donnah - snow seems to be on the horizon.” Clearly her transformation into an air elemental had left a residue of weather divining - it was a good forecast.

“So our first lesson is how to catch a unicorn!” continued William, watching to see Donnah’s reaction.

Donnah looked at him quizzically. “A unicorn - are you sure, I’m pretty sure there are no such things as unicorns.”

“True, on this world there used not to be; unfortunately a good natured prank has released all sorts of fauna in this forest here that shouldn’t belong. And before you ask, yes it is true that maidens have an advantage in catching them - however this is a test of skill and an opportunity for me to help you understand more of the wonders of nature. This will be your first ‘Wild Hunt’; something of a rite of passage for those in my line of work.”

Donnah shook her head, bemused by the prospect of the day ahead. “Well it’s not what I expected when I agreed to grandfather’s suggestion of you training me, but few things are quite what they seem these days.”

William tossed over a canvas bag to his younger apprentice. “A gift.”

The young woman opened the bag to find a pair of stout outdoor walking boots.

“In my line of work a flash pair of heeled boots are great when you have a cape that allows you to fly; but are next to useless trekking across the wilderness. And the trainers...sorry sneakers you are wearing will perish too quickly where we are going.”

After five minutes Dr’s Wildman and Arcane stood shoulder to shoulder, Donnah wearing her new boots. “Shall we?” suggested William and took off at a steady pace into the woodlands, his younger apprentice following him…

Four hours later the two crouched in the lee of a rocky outcrop. Donnah looked a little out of breath but was making a good show of learning the tricks and tips William was passing on - some practical survival skills, others being references to druidism.

“As with all magical schools there are aptitudes and specialisms - mine it would appear are centered around my knowledge of animals. I can tap into the eldritch energies and filter them through my understanding of zoology to transform. I’ve also had the privilege of travelling the world looking for rare animals or surviving extreme conditions to entertain TV viewers and so again channel the energy and think of the place and I can create a teleportation gate to get me there.”

“So as I said earlier unicorns like maidens not men so it's time for me to go...”

With that he clapped his hands together - “Size of a wolf!”

With a shimmer of emerald eldritch energy where Dr Wildman once stood now appeared a white and grey furred wolf. It sniffed the air as the first flakes of snow started to fall. With a bark and a bound, off he ran - Donnah sprinting behind him. …
